Troubleshooting

Why Your QR Code Won’t Scan (And How to Fix It)

Apr 25, 2026 نُشر بواسطة Scan QR Code
Why Your QR Code Won’t Scan (And How to Fix It)

QR codes are designed to be fast and easy to scan, but sometimes they fail to work as expected. When a QR code won’t scan, the issue is usually related to quality, device limitations, or environmental factors.

Understanding the common reasons behind scanning failures — and how to fix them — helps ensure a smooth and reliable experience.

Common Reasons Why QR Codes Don’t Scan

Several factors can prevent a QR code from being detected or decoded properly.

Low Image Quality

Blurry, pixelated, or low-resolution QR codes are difficult to scan.

If the QR code is not sharp, scanners may fail to recognize the pattern.

Poor Lighting Conditions

Lighting plays a major role in scanning.

Too dark or overly bright environments can reduce visibility and affect detection.

Incorrect Size or Distance

A QR code that is too small or too far away may not be captured correctly by the scanner.

Maintaining proper distance improves accuracy.

Damaged or Distorted QR Code

If a QR code is partially covered, scratched, or distorted, it may not scan.

Even small damage can affect readability.

Low Contrast

QR codes require strong contrast between the foreground and background.

Light-on-light or dark-on-dark combinations reduce scannability.

Camera Limitations

Older devices or low-quality cameras may struggle to scan QR codes effectively.

Focus and resolution play a key role.

Unsupported Format or Content

Some QR codes may contain data formats that certain scanners cannot interpret.

Using a reliable scanner helps avoid compatibility issues.

How to Fix QR Code Scanning Issues

Fixing scanning problems usually involves simple adjustments.

Improve Image Quality

Use high-resolution QR codes and avoid compression.

Clear and sharp images scan more reliably.

Adjust Lighting

Ensure balanced lighting conditions.

Avoid reflections and extreme brightness.

Resize or Reposition the QR Code

Make the QR code large enough and keep it within the scanner frame.

Proper positioning improves detection speed.

Check for Damage

If the QR code is damaged, try to replace it with a clean version.

For digital use, always keep a backup copy.

Increase Contrast

Use dark QR codes on light backgrounds.

High contrast improves scanning accuracy.

Use an Online QR Code Scanner

A qr code scanner online can help detect QR codes from images or screenshots, even when camera scanning fails.

This method is useful for digital QR codes.

Try Another Device or Browser

Switching devices or using a different browser may resolve compatibility issues.

Scan QR Code from Image as a Solution

If the QR code cannot be scanned using a camera, using a scan qr code from image method can be more effective.

Uploading the QR code image directly allows the system to decode it without relying on camera conditions.

Best Practices to Avoid Scanning Issues

To ensure QR codes always work properly:

  • Use high-quality images
  • Maintain proper contrast
  • Avoid distortion
  • Test QR codes before sharing
  • Keep backup versions

Preventing issues is easier than fixing them later.

When QR Codes Still Don’t Work

If a QR code still does not scan:

  • Verify that the content is valid
  • Check if the link or data is active
  • Ensure the QR code was generated correctly

Sometimes the issue is related to the content, not the scanning process.

Final Verdict

When a QR code won’t scan, the problem is usually caused by image quality, lighting, or device limitations.

Most issues can be resolved quickly by improving conditions or using alternative scanning methods.

Conclusion

QR code scanning issues are common but easy to fix.

By understanding the causes and applying the right solutions, users can ensure reliable scanning across all devices and environments.